Fiberglass cutting robots are used in the Marine, Automotive, Aerospace, and Other industries for precision cutting of fiberglass materials. In the Marine industry, these robots are used for manufacturing boat hulls and components. In the Automotive industry, they are utilized for cutting fiberglass parts for vehicles. In the Aerospace sector, fiberglass cutting robots are employed for producing aircraft components. The Other category includes applications in construction, sports equipment, and more. The fastest-growing application segment in terms of revenue is the Aerospace industry, due to the increasing demand for lightweight and durable materials in aircraft manufacturing.
